More TIII treasures.


T3,

Yesterday, while looking for some rear torsion bars at my local aircooled
garage, I stumbled onto the, "Tyypi 3", shelf.  This was pretty wierd,
because I have been cataloging and sorting much of the old, used parts
there for a couple of years now and I have never really paid attention to
that particular area of the warehouse - I should have.  Maybe I just got
bored with all of the crappy TI, TII and TIV engines laying around ... this
junk goes up to the roof.

I managed to go through some of it and found a few things of value - at
least for my car.  Otherwise, nothing too unusual.  Quite a lot of them are
still in the VW dealer plastic bags, marked with PN's and are impossible to
ID.  What I did check out was all NOS stuff from various years, apparently
bought by the owner of the garage (VWauhtipiste of Turku, Finland) from a
dealer that went under some years ago.

The NOS parts included (this is from memory and I was dizzy with happiness):

-- 10 pairs of bumper brackets: the vintage is unclear, looks to be early
-- 4 sets of front disc brake spindles
-- numerous front axle parts, torsion bars, bearings and so on
-- 1 set of rear brake drums
-- 3 pairs of late model rear turn signal housing seals (also some used pairs)
-- one brand new, late model turn signal housing (clean enough to eat off of)
-- 2 pairs of heat exchanger protection plates (mounted at the bend in the
exchanger)
-- 1 pair of front brake discs
-- 2 plastic fuel pump covers, vintage unknown
-- transmission mounts
-- 1 brand new Hella license plate light assembly (2 lights, all lenses
intact, all wiring there) for late model Squareback (?)
-- 5 factory primered doors of various years (all passenger side)
-- 4 sets of rear or front bonnet/hatch/door/trunk latch mechanisms for
different years (found only one set which works for my '67, rest is for
later years)
-- 5 new pairs of windshield wiper arms (grey/silver), vintage unknown (not
'67 at least)
-- 10 pairs of both rear hatch and front bonnet hinges, primered
-- 5 pairs of door hinge plates
-- assorted hoses for under the dash and back seat
-- lots of other engine parts & plastic interior parts that I cannot identify

The used OEM parts stash included:

-- 2 more sets of late model turn signal lenses + housings
-- engine compartment seals
-- 1 pair of side marker housings and lenses
-- 1 grey faced speedo
-- one pair of front turn signal housings to 1967
-- one FB or NB license plate light assembly with lense and housing (this
is about 35cm long and has a ribbed chrome section down the middle - no "S"
marking) attaches to the rear hatch
-- rear marker housings
-- fuse box covers
-- 1 pair of tail light lense housings to 1969?
-- 2 front bonnets


I am going to have to look at the rest and try to figure out what it all
is.  There was too much to take in all at once.  I thought I was drunk just
looking at all.  I have that multi-lingual parts manual from VW and several
other OEM factory parts manual (in Finnish) which may help.

I suppose that most of it is for sale - there are so few TIII Volkswagens
here, that no one will ever ask for any of this.  If anyone is interested,
please mail me.  A few of the OEM parts look so new, it is hard to believe
that they have been up there for 20 years.
